WHO WE ARE:
Widows and Orphans Empowerment Organisation (WEWE) is a not-for-profit, non-governmental organisation (NGO) that was founded in 2004 by Dr. Josephine Ogazi and Mr. Joseph Egwuonwu.
WEWE started out as a community-based organisation (CBO) with the aim of providing scholarships and economic empowerment to widows and orphans in Okigwe, Imo State and has since expanded its aims, objectives, and development programs to Abuja, Abia, Anambra, Akwa Ibom, Benue, Enugu, Oyo, Rivers states.
WEWE is registered as a national NGO with CAC under incorporated trustees and its registration number is CAC/IT/NO33132
